Superconducting thin films of the Bi-Sr-Ca-Cu-O system (2 and 10 kA) have been successfully prepared by multilayer deposition from elemental metal sources and annealed in N2/02 mixtures. The onset of the superconducting transition is greater than 80 K with zero resistance at 74 K. The films contain primarily a Bi2 (SrCaBi) 3Cu208+ sphase with a high degrees of (001) preferred orientation. © 1988, Materials Research Society. All rights reserved.
